Available for work

Full-Stack SWE &
Cloud Developer

Building scalable web applications with TypeScript, React, and Next.js.
Expertise in cloud platforms (AWS), microservices, and DevOps practices.

TypeScriptReactNext.jsAWSDockerKubernetesNode.jsPython
0+
Years Professional
12
Years Coding
15+
Technologies Mastered

Skills & Experience

Technologies I work with and years of experience

๐ŸŒ

Web Development

REST APIs9+ years
React5+ years
Next.js3+ years
Tailwind CSS2+ years
GraphQL2+ years
โš™๏ธ

Backend Technologies

Java12+ years
Node.js / TypeScript 10+ years
PHP9+ years
Python5+ years
Express.js5+ years
Microservices4+ years
Kafka4+ years
Fastify2+ years
๐Ÿงช

Testing & Build Tools

Webpack5+ years
Jest4+ years
Cypress4+ years
Vite3+ years
Astro2+ years
๐Ÿ’พ

Databases

MySQL12+ years
PostgreSQL9+ years
MongoDB8+ years
โ˜๏ธ

Cloud Platforms & DevOps

Linux13+ years
Git12+ years
AWS6+ years
Docker6+ years
Jenkins6+ years
Kubernetes5+ years

Professional Experience

My journey through various companies and roles that shaped my expertise

U.S. Cellular logo

Software Engineer

U.S. Cellular

September 2022 - Present
Chicago, IL

Developed and deployed three self-service tools featuring RBAC and SSO, leveraging React, Next.js, and MongoDB; reduced configuration change deployment times, improving system agility. Devised, implemented, and supported over 30 microservices that dynamically controlled per-customer network speeds for over 5 million users, enhancing system design, scalability, and reliability.

ReactNext.jsTypeScriptExpressMongoDBKafkaGraphQLPostgreSQLESLintMochaSplunk
U.S. Cellular logo

Associate Software Engineer

U.S. Cellular

May 2021 - September 2022
Chicago, IL

Designed REST APIs and GraphQL schemas for websites to fulfill government mandates (CIPA, FCC Nutrition Labels), achieving compliance. Initiated the implementation of ESLint, unit testing (mocha), and Splunk structured logging to modernize the codebase and enforce CI/CD standards, achieving zero major outages and 100% on-time delivery.

TypeScriptExpressREST APIsGraphQLPostgreSQLESLintMochaSplunkMaterial UIShadcn
Gorden & Co., P.C. logo

Software Engineer Intern

Gorden & Co., P.C.

May 2019 - September 2019
Oak Brook, IL

Developed a customer-facing API using Node.js, Express, React, and MongoDB to automate contract generation, reducing admin work time. Created an employee time tracking system to calculate PTO and minimize human errors, reducing the weekly payroll workload from an hour to a few minutes.

Node.jsExpressReactMongoDBAPI Development

Featured Projects

A showcase of my recent work and side projects

๐Ÿ’ป

DocuFuse

SaaS document signing platform for small businesses and freelancers. Pay-as-you-go pricing at $1.50-$2.50 per signature - an affordable alternative to DocuSign.

Next.jsTypeScriptSaaSDocument SigningStripe
๐Ÿ’ป

Pixelcade Minecraft Server

Enterprise-scale Minecraft server core that supported 100k+ registered users. Modular architecture with 40+ custom plugins including economy, gangs, private mines, auctions, and web panel.

JavaMinecraftBukkitMySQLDiscord IntegrationWeb Panel
๐Ÿ’ป

Accoutant Internal Management System

Full-stack business management platform for an accounting firm. Features advanced time tracking, PTO management, employee administration, document signing, and automated payroll reporting.

AstroReactTypeScriptPostgreSQLClerk AuthBusiness Management
๐Ÿ’ป

Parlay Picker

Sports betting group parlay builder with live odds integration. Create private groups, select games from multiple sportsbooks, and collaboratively build parlays with friends using real-time odds data.

AstroReactTypeScriptLive Odds APISports BettingGroup Collaboration
๐Ÿ’ป

Stock Insights Tracker

Python-based congressional stock trading monitor with email notifications. Contributed to generalize the system for tracking any member of Congress, not just specific individuals.

PythonWeb ScrapingEmail NotificationsDockerOpen Source
๐Ÿ’ป

Chess Game with AI

Interactive chess game built with Preact and TypeScript. Features a chess AI opponent using minimax algorithm with alpha-beta pruning, complete move validation, and checkmate detection.

PreactTypeScriptChess AIMinimax AlgorithmGame DevelopmentVite
๐Ÿ’ป

ADS-B Unraid Templates

Aviation tracking passion project with Unraid templates for monitoring nearby aircraft traffic. Includes configurations for FlightAware, ADS-B Exchange, FR24, and RadarBox feeds.

AviationADS-BUnraidDockerAircraft TrackingXML

What I'm Learning Right Now

I'm passionate about continuous learning and staying up-to-date with the latest technologies and best practices in software development.

Programming Languages

Rust

Systems programming, memory safety, and performance optimization

Infrastructure & DevOps

Terraform

Infrastructure as Code and cloud resource management

AI & Machine Learning

Machine Learning

Deep learning algorithms, neural networks, and model training

Generative AI

Large language models, prompt engineering, and AI applications

Always learning, always growing

Beyond Code

When I'm not coding, you'll find me exploring these passions

๐Ÿ‘จโ€๐Ÿณ

Cooking

๐Ÿ–จ๏ธ

3D Printing

๐ŸŽฎ

Gaming

๐Ÿš›

Traveling

๐Ÿ›ฉ๏ธ

Learning to Fly